I have just bought a Jeep Liberty (Cherokee)KJ 2.5CRD - 2004 model and I suspect that it has the incorrect motor oil level dipstick. The present dipstick has an overall length of 584mm and when I filled the motor with the required 6.5 liters of oil (with filter change), started the motor and switched off and measured the oil level with the dipstick - oil level was way over the full mark on the dipstick. I suspect that the dipstick I have is for the 2.8CRD. Can anyone tell me what the correct dipstick length is for my motor? I think it should be around 560mm long. The dipstick does not have a Jeep part number on it and Jeep have no idea what the correct length should be!

The 2004 Parts fiche gives both 2.5 and 2.8 dipstick PN as: 05072682AB while the 2006 Parts Fiche gives the PN for the 2.8
L CRD as: 05142662AB.
I think some engines have the oil filter mounted further down on a long extension tube....which would take a bit more oil...while some are shown without this long tube and the oil filter is mounted further up but dipstick PN stays the same!
